§ 1807.200. Applicant eligibility.

(a)General requirements. An Applicant will be deemed eligible to apply for a CMF Award if it is:
(1)A Certified CDFI. An entity may meet the requirements described in this paragraph (a)(1) if it is:
(i)A Certified CDFI, as set forth in 12 CFR 1805.201;
(ii)A Certified CDFI that has been in existence as a legally formed entity as set forth in the applicable Notice of Funds Availability (NOFA); or
(2)A Nonprofit Organization having as one of its principal purposes, the development or management of affordable housing. A Nonprofit Organization may meet the requirements described in this paragraph (a)(2) if it:
(i)Has been in existence as a legally formed entity as set forth in the applicable NOFA;
(ii)Demonstrates, through articles of incorporation, by-laws, or other board- approved documents, that the development or management of affordable housing are among its principal purposes; and
(iii)Demonstrates, by providing information described in the Application, NOFA, and/or supplemental information, as may be requested by the CDFI Fund, that a certain percentage, set forth in the applicable NOFA, of the Applicant's total assets are dedicated to the development or management of affordable housing.
(b)Eligibility verification. An Applicant shall demonstrate that it meets the eligibility requirements described in paragraph (a)(2) of this section by providing information described in the Application, NOFA, and/or supplemental information, as may be requested by the CDFI Fund. For an Applicant seeking eligibility under paragraph (a)(1) of this section, the CDFI Fund will verify that the Applicant is a Certified CDFI as described in the applicable NOFA.
